FT231X USB to Full Handshake UART

Download the FT231X USB to Full Handshake UART driver here. The FT231X is a USB2.0 Full Speed IC that seamlessly connects full handshake UART interfaces. As a UART device, it supports data transfer rates up to 3M Baud while consuming low power (8mA).

With the comprehensive FT-X series feature set, it simplifies the integration of USB into system designs through a UART interface. This compact bridge offers reliable and efficient USB connectivity, enhancing the versatility and compatibility of various applications.

Hardware Features

The Single chip USB to asynchronous serial data transfer interface provides a seamless solution for connecting USB to asynchronous serial devices. With the entire USB protocol handled on the chip, there is no need for USB-specific firmware programming. The device features a fully integrated 2048 byte EEPROM for storing device descriptors and CBUS I/O configuration, making it convenient to configure and customize.

The integrated clock generation eliminates the need for an external crystal and offers optional clock output selection, enabling a hassle-free interface to external MCUs or FPGAs. The data transfer rates range from 300 baud to 3 Mbaud, catering to various communication needs. The receive and transmit buffers, each with a capacity of 512 bytes, utilize buffer smoothing technology to ensure efficient and high-speed data throughput. In addition to compare, also look at the FT230X Basic UART Driver and FT232RL USB to Serial Driver on this website.

Driver Software

FTDI provides royalty-free Virtual Com Port (VCP) and Direct (D2XX) drivers, simplifying USB driver development in most cases. The CBUS I/O pins are configurable, allowing for flexible I/O configurations. Additionally, the device supports transmit and receive LED drive signals, facilitating visual feedback during data transfer operations.

The UART interface offers support for 7 or 8 data bits, 1 or 2 stop bits, and various parity options, providing versatility in data transmission. Furthermore, the device offers synchronous and asynchronous bit bang interface options with RD# and WR# strobes, expanding its range of applications.


The Battery Charger Detection feature is particularly useful for mobile devices as it enables the detection of a charger on the USB port, facilitating higher current and faster charging of batteries. Each device is pre-programmed with a unique USB serial number, ensuring identification and differentiation.

The device is compatible with bus-powered, self-powered, and high-power bus-powered USB configurations, accommodating different power requirements. It integrates a +3.3V level converter for USB I/O, offering seamless communication between different voltage levels. The True 3.3V CMOS drive output and TTL input ensure reliable signal transmission, with the capability to operate down to 1V8 with external pull-ups. Additionally, the I/O pin output drive strength is configurable, allowing for customization based on specific needs.


In addition an integrated power-on-reset circuit ensures reliable startup and operation. The UART signal inversion option provides flexibility in signal inversion requirements. The device incorporates internal 3.3V/1.8V LDO regulators, enabling stable voltage regulation for optimal performance. Likewise see also the FT231X – Full Speed USB to Full UART as well as the FT231X USB UART Driver.

Likewise with a low operating current of 8mA (typical) and USB suspend current of 125uA (typical). Additionally the device is power-efficient. It consumes low USB bandwidth, maximizing the available bandwidth for other USB devices.

Moreover the compatibility with UHCI/OHCI/EHCI host controllers ensures seamless integration with different host controller architectures. Furthermore, it is fully compatible with USB 2.0 Full Speed, providing reliable and high-speed USB connectivity.

Note that the device operates reliably across an extended temperature range of -40°C to 85°C, making it suitable for various environmental conditions. Likewise it is available in compact Pb-free 16 Pin SSOP and QFN packages, complying with RoHS regulations for environmentally friendly manufacturing processes.

Application Usage

In addition the USB to RS232/RS422/RS485 Converters provide seamless connectivity between USB and legacy devices. Likewise enabling the upgrade of outdated devices to USB compatibility. These converters are versatile and find applications in various scenarios, such as transferring data between cellular and cordless phones and USB interfaces.

Also facilitating communication between MCU/PLD/FPGA based designs and USB, and enabling USB-based audio and low bandwidth video transfer. Additionally, they support PDA to USB data transfer, making it convenient to connect PDAs to USB-enabled devices for easy data exchange.


D2XX Direct Drivers

Windows (Desktop) 2021-07-15

FT231X Driver X86 (64-Bit)

FT231X Driver X86 (32-Bit)

Windows RT Driver (ARM) (2014-07-04)

Linux X64 (64-Bit) / X86 (32-Bit)  (2020-05-18)


VCP Drivers

Windows (Desktop) 2021-07-15

FT231 X Driver X86 (64-Bit)

FT231X Driver X86 (32-Bit)